Do you have an ideia why the "hell" this has been solved by setting the PDF degub to on and then put it back to off???
 
Flicking through the code suggests that shouldn't have happened ..... So maybe pretend that it didn't. :)

I'm sure there is an explanation but without knowing the exact sequence of events it's hard to say. It may have been a blip in your settings between Github releases or something like that.
 
Do you have an ideia why the "hell" this has been solved by setting the PDF degub to on and then put it back to off
Perhaps if you had never saved the global config since that option was added, there might have been a mismatch between the default value that we use if one wasn't recorded for that option and the default shown in the config.
 
Ahhh, that makes sense, because i've never checked that option before.
